Comprehending Sash Windows
[Sash Window Restoration Specialists](https://6.k1668.cn/home.php?mod=space&uid=496465) windows are discovered in many historical and contemporary structures, especially in Victorian and Georgian styles. They normally consist of 2 or more panes that slide vertically along a set of tracks.
Secret Components of Sash WindowsPartDescriptionSashesThe frame holding the glass panes, able to go up and down.Pulley-block SystemA system that enables the sashes to move smoothly.WeightsCounterbalance the sash motion, often hidden within the frame.RailsHorizontal tracks where the sashes slide.StopsPrevent sashes from falling totally out of the frame.
These windows serve the dual function of offering ventilation and natural light, while likewise adding an ornamental component to a residential or commercial property.


Common Problems with Sash Windows
Despite their durability, sash windows can encounter numerous problems, which may require professional attention. Below are some of the most common issues:
ProblemDescriptionDrafts and Air LeakageOften brought on by worn-out seals or misalignments.Rotted WoodWooden sash frames can rot due to moisture direct exposure.Broken or Cloudy GlassHarmed panes can lead to minimized insulation and presence.Sticking SashesAccumulation of paint or lack of lubrication causes sashes to stick.Ineffective OperationDifficulty in opening or closing the windows due to weight imbalance.
